THE Global Sustainable Development Congress 2024

THE Global Sustainable Development Congress 2024 will be held in Bangkok, Thailand from 10 to 13 June 2024. CUHK is delighted to participate in the congress as a regional co-host.

The congress is expected to draw over 3,000 global thought leaders, policymakers, industry executives, and civil society representatives to discuss solutions to the global sustainability emergency.

CUHK will be represented by a large delegation comprising members of the University management, esteemed professors specializing in sustainable development research and projects as well as student ambassadors to share their experience at serval panel discussions.

Universities have a responsibility to bring about sustainable development in society. They are expected to be responsive to pressing societal issues and sustainability challenges and to act to integrate changes in internal organization, knowledge creation, educational models, information technologies, social responsibility and knowledge transfer.

 

As one of Hong Kong’s pioneering universities, CUHK takes a holistic approach to social responsibility, connecting and articulating its vision, goals and priorities to guide planning and management practices. We are resolved to establish ourselves at the forefront of social responsibility and to address various sustainable development targets, ranging from health to education, inclusion to partnerships, and climate action to responsible processes.

 

The University seeks to ensure that all its members understand and identify with CUHK’s values and are engaged in the quest for a sustainable world both for themselves and for those who follow in their footsteps.
